System for dynamic and automatic building mapping
First Claim
1. A system for the automatic and dynamic tracking of an user'"'"'s position relative to an interior of a building having a plurality of interconnected rooms, comprising:
- means, transportable by said user, for generating data indicative of a distance between said user and walls of a room in which said user is presently located;
means for locating said position of said user in said building;
means for cumulatively mapping the extent of each room in which said user is located and said user'"'"'s position relative to said room to produce a map of said user'"'"'s position relative to said interior of said building;
means for transmitting said map to a tracking entity;
means for displaying said map to said tracking entity;
wherein said tracking entity can monitor said position of said user relative to said interior of said building; and
sensor means for measuring at least one of building and user parameters;
ambient temperature, presence of toxic gasses, oxygen level in a breathing tank, time to exhaustion of breathable air in the breathing tank, user breathing rate and heart rate sensors, user time in area, a user failure to move indicator, command and control alerts, text readout of messages from the command and control system, voice activation of the unit including the display, location of other users in the vicinity, warning indications.

Abstract
The automatic building mapping system comprises a tracker module that can be carried by a user and an optional command module which operate to automatically map the rooms of a building as a user traverses the rooms of the building. The tracker module includes a transducer system that determines the present distance from the user to each of the walls of the room, the location of openings in the walls as well as an inertial guidance system that precisely locates the user with respect to a known reference point. The data produced by the tracker module of the automatic building mapping system can be transmitted to a centrally located command module so that multiple units can simultaneously be tracked and a mapping of the building effected from different perspectives to thereby create an accurate composite layout map. In addition, the user can receive a heads-up display to enable the user to visualize the layout of the building as the user traverses the various rooms of the building, and as concurrently mapped by other users in the building. Thus, an accurate virtual map can be created on demand by the users moving through the rooms of the building.
